There are significant differences between dry oil-free screw air compressor and micro-oil air compressor in many aspects.
First of all, from the working principle, the dry oil-free screw air compressor mainly compresses the air in the air inlet through the mutual engagement of the two screws, without the use of lubricating oil, so it will not produce oil mist and oil-gas mixture. The micro-oil air compressor uses a rotary compressor, and uses a small amount of oil mist to lubricate and cool the mechanical parts during the compression process to reduce wear and extend the life of the parts.
Secondly, from the perspective of performance and application scenarios, dry oil-free screw air compressors have the advantages of energy saving, low noise, and long life, and are widely used in industries that require extremely high air quality, such as medical, food and electronics. Due to its oil-free characteristics, it ensures the safe operation of equipment in these industries and avoids various problems caused by oil pollution. Because of its high energy efficiency, low maintenance cost, small size and light weight, micro-oil air compressors are widely used in fields that require stable air flow, such as automobile manufacturing and construction.
Furthermore, from the oil content and the impact on the equipment, the dry oil-free screw air compressor completely avoids the problem of oil pollution, reducing equipment failure and maintenance costs caused by oil pollution. Although the micro-oil air compressor uses an oil and gas separator to reduce the oil content, there are still trace amounts of oil, which may have a certain impact on some applications that require extremely high air quality.
Finally, from a maintenance point of view, dry oil-free screw air compressors reduce the need to replace lubricating oil and oil filters due to their oil-free characteristics, thereby reducing maintenance costs. The micro-oil air compressor needs regular inspection and replacement of lubricating oil to ensure its normal operation.
In summary, there are significant differences between dry oil-free screw air compressors and micro-oil air compressors in terms of working principle, performance, application scenarios, oil content, impact on equipment, and maintenance requirements. When choosing, you should decide which type of air compressor to use according to the specific application requirements and the use environment.

Screw air compressor, per cubic meter of compressed gas inside, the oil content is about three to five milligrams. Although this value looks very small, if the gas consumption is very large and accumulates over time, a lot of oil will still be accumulated in the pipelines and gas-using equipment.
